Abstract :
With the growing use of multiradio mobile terminals a vertical handoff between different wireless access technologies is becoming increasingly common. The vertical hand-off may result in a significant change in the access link characteristics that can affect the performance of TCP dramatically as its behaviour depends on the end-to-end path properties that also change consequently. We propose a number of simple enhancements to the TCP sender algorithm which make use of explicit information about the change in the link characteristics due to handoff. We study the effectiveness of the enhancements in a simulated WLAN-GPRS environment with different handoff scenarios. The enhancements are shown to improve TCP performance significantly
